Karnataka High Court Issues Notice on Mohammed Zubair's Plea for Transit Bail - (23 Jun 2021)

CRIMINAL

Karnataka High Court has issued notice on a petition filed by Mohammed Zubair, co-founder of fact-checking portal 'AltNews', seeking transit anticipatory bail in a First Information Report registered by Uttar Pradesh police over tweets on the Ghaziabad incident related to assault on an elderly Muslim man.
